In triangle ABC, the lengths of the sides in feet are a=23, b=14, c=18 . Find angle C.

Answer: Angle C = 51.5°

Step-by-step explanation:

The diagram of the triangle is shown in the attached photo.

we would apply the law of Cosines which is expressed as

c² = a² + b² - 2bcCosC

Where a,b and c are the length of each side of the triangle and C is the angle corresponding to c.

Therefore,

18² = 23² + 14² - 2(23 × 14)CosC

324 = 529 + 196 - 2(322)CosC

324 = 725 - 644CosC

644CosC = 725 - 324

644CosC = 401

CosC = 401/644

CosC = 0.623

C = Cos^- 1(0.623)

C = 51.5° to the nearest tenth
